The Battle of Zumar was fought between the Islamic State and Kurdish Peshmerga troops over the city of Zumar in Nineveh province in northern Iraq. It started when IS launched an offensive on Zummar from 1–4 August 2014, resulting in its capture. On 25 October, after US airstrikes, Kurdish Peshmerga troops succeeded in recapturing the city, after an unsuccessful attempt to hold it in September.
